Does the new E has the one twist auto start feature?

Hi,

Does the 2003 E-class has the one touch auto start feature on the ignition switch? You know, the feature that you don't have to keep the key in the start position until the engine start, just one quick turn then the starter will crank until the engine starts.

Dlau,

Indeed, to start the engine, being an electronic key, you don't have to hold the key in the start position. Just flick it to start and release. This is one thing that my sales rep made a point to show me.
